Nitrogen is one of the primary macronutrients required for plant development. It is a key component of amino acids, proteins, and nucleic acids, playing a crucial role in various physiological functions. When nitrogen is adequately supplied, plants flourish, displaying rich green foliage and robust growth.
Chlorophyll production, necessary for photosynthesis, relies heavily on nitrogen. This means that a nitrogen-rich environment leads to greener leaves, which in turn fosters greater light absorption. Yellowing leaves, often linked to nitrogen deficiency, can be a distressing sight for gardeners. Addressing this nutrient gap through nitrogen fertilizer can revitalize your plants, enhancing their overall appearance and vitality.
Using nitrogen fertilizer effectively involves overcoming several challenges. Customers often encounter issues such as over-fertilization, improper timing, and choice of product. Let’s explore solutions to these problems.
With various types of nitrogen fertilizers available (including urea, ammonium nitrate, and calcium nitrate), it can be daunting to choose the right product. Here, it’s crucial to consider your soil's current nitrogen levels and the specific needs of your plants. Soil testing can provide valuable insights, indicating whether you require a quick-release fertilizer for immediate action or a slow-release option for extended feeding.
Applying nitrogen at the right growth stage is vital. Early application can promote foliage at the expense of root and fruit development. Conversely, late application may not benefit the current growing cycle. A general guideline is to apply nitrogen in the spring when plants are awakening and actively growing. Staying attuned to your plants' development can help in determining the right moment for application.

Utilizing nitrogen fertilizer not only enhances initial growth but also leads to several long-term benefits:
Improved nitrogen levels often translate to higher crop yields and better quality produce. Healthy plants typically resist pests and disease better, thereby reducing losses and enhancing marketability. For commercial growers, this means a more profitable harvest, while home gardeners enjoy bountiful vegetable and flower collections.
Interestingly, adequate nitrogen supports microbial activity in the soil, which is essential for nutrient cycling. This contributes to a healthier soil ecosystem, further promoting plant growth. Balancing nitrogen levels with other nutrients like phosphorus and potassium is key for sustainable gardening and farming practices.
